Predicting the Oregon Ducks' Defensive Two-Deep Prior to Spring Training

Just days away, Oregon spring football practice begins, and I'm guessing Tosh Lupoi's defense's two-deep.

I forecasted the offense's two-deep yesterday, and Oregon's defense might improve in 2024 with a lot of returning starters and excellent transfer prospects.
